HR3100/Lecture/A2 - Employee & Labour Relations | Credits 3.00
This course provides a broad understanding of employee and labour relations in Canada. Topics included are the collective bargaining process, perspectives from employee, management, and union, and the history of unions. This course will also look at the challenges of employee and labour relations and using resources to help resolve these issues. Prerequisites: BA1380, BA2240
